As Sony announced, Ghost of Yotei will be released on New Game Plus on November 24 with a free update. Expect increased difficulty, modern armor sets and weapon dyes, replayable missions, and modern accessibility options.

The PlayStation 5 exclusive Sucker Punch sequel will receive New Game Plus as a free update with modern cosmetics, modern trophies and modern Photo Mode features.

As described in detail wa Post on the PlayStation BlogNew Game Plus will allow you to replay Atsu’s mission from the beginning, using everything you’ve earned throughout the campaign. “Yes, this means it’s time to bring your weapons to swordfighting, and all the armor, skills and weapons from your first playthrough will be available from the start of the game,” said Andrew Goldfarb, senior communications manager at Sucker Punch Productions.

Details of the modern Ghost of Yotei Plus game:

New Game Plus will unlock after completing the main story and will add modern, harder difficulty options and two modern trophies. There is also a modern currency called Spirit Flowers, which can be exchanged at the modern vendor for over 30 modern cosmetics, including modern armor sets and weapon dyes, as well as 10 modern amulets. You’ll also be able to earn an additional level of upgrades for your existing armor and weapon sets.

New base game features coming with the modern patch include the ability to replay post-game content after completing the main story, including a modern stat display. Sucker Punch also adds modern accessibility options, including remapping the directional buttons. New Photo Mode features include shutter speed, composition grid, and modern filters.

Last week, Sony announced that Ghost of Yotei had sold 3.3 million copies in its first month of sales (October 2 to November 2). The predecessor Ghost of Tsushima sold 2.4 million copies in the first three days after going on sale exclusively on PlayStation 4 on July 17, 2020, and then reached 5 million after 118 days (less than four months). Including sales of the director’s cut on PC and PS5, 13 million copies have already been sold.

So it’s worth remembering that while we don’t have figures for a comparable sales period, it appears that Ghost of Yotei is selling as well as Ghost of Tsushima before it, a suggestion supported by sales data in the US and across Europe.

As for developer Sucker Punch’s future plans, in an interview with VGCco-founder and head of the studio, Brian Fleming, said that the studio will decide on the next project after the release of the multiplayer expansion Ghost of Yotei: Legends. But he suggested don’t expect an avalanche of games from a relatively humble developer – it’s one project at a time.
